Embassy Court

Completed in 1935 and restored in 2005, Embassy Court is a striking 11-storey building of luxurious apartments and one of the best examples of pre-war Modernist architecture in the UK. With heritage status, it represents a departure from the Art Deco style of the 1930s towards early Modernism.
